Firefox 10 is currently a Beta version and Norton doesn't support pre-release Beta versions. See this regarding Firefox 9.0.

http://community.norton.com/t5/Norton-Internet-Security-Norton/Firefox-9-Support-for-Norton-Toolbar/td-p/615563

Basically, just run Norton Live Update as often as you need to - some users have said it took 3 or 4 tries for the Live Update to retrieve the updated Norton extensions for Firefox.
